Output 61fc79751c7a4e3103f1ac8a4ef4b0ecc144c632a171b72fb3eb7e3ce89f939a:0

value
74997200
script pubkey
OP_0 OP_PUSHBYTES_20 f509fb95afd4d22282335fd7e8609a028574ce15
address
bc1q75ylh9d06nfz9q3ntlt7scy6q2zhfns45uwttv
transaction
61fc79751c7a4e3103f1ac8a4ef4b0ecc144c632a171b72fb3eb7e3ce89f939a
spent
true